This alert fires when the ParcelPing webhook from our carrier partner, Swiftrunner Logistics, stops delivering tracking events for more than ten minutes. Downstream, customer tracking pages at Cartonly go stale, which drives support volume quickly. Before paging anyone, verify the ingest queue depth and the carrier status feed. The triage checklist lives on the page below.

runbook for badug-kadup: https://confluence.zemvarlabs.internal/projects/browse/display/projects/bd1b

## Ticket: Retention sweeper drift across plugin sandboxes

The Hollowbine data-retention sweeper is running with different settings in each plugin sandbox, causing inconsistent purge timing for plugin-generated records. Authors report test fixtures vanishing early in some sandboxes and lingering in others. We will reconverge all sandboxes this week; please pin your tests to the canonical settings. The authoritative sweeper configuration is as follows.

settings of kagag-kagef:
[kelath]
port = 9300
region = west-4
host = kelath.olvarqworks.example
team = sorion
timeout_ms = 1000
retries = 8

## Releases

ShelfStream publishes catalogue-import builds monthly. Plugin authors must target the import schema pinned in each release tag; MARC-variant mappings change between minors, so re-run the Stackwise conformance suite before publishing. Unsigned plugin bundles are rejected by the registry. All official ShelfStream artifacts are signed; verify downloads before building against them using the key below.

release key, yafof-kadup: bky4_soBk

## Deploying the Gatewick Proctor Queue

Deploys are pretty painless: push to main, wait for the pipeline, then watch the queue drain dashboard for five minutes. If candidates pile up mid-exam, roll back first and ask questions later — the queue replays safely. Everything the workers care about lives in one config block, shown here for reference.

settings of bafof-yagef:
JOROX_PIN=8740
JOROX_TENANT=pelox
JOROX_METRICS_HOST=metrics.jorox.qorvelworks.internal
JOROX_SEAL=seal_c78f63c1
JOROX_STANDBY_TEAM=norax